On the night of 9 July, Russia attacked Ukraine with 741 air attack vehicles.

This was reported by the command of the Ukrainian Air Force.

Russian military attacked with 728 Shahed-type strike drones and various types of drone simulators from the following directions: Bryansk, Primorsko-Akhtarsk, Kursk, Orel, Millerovo (Russian Federation); – 7 X-101/Iskander-K cruise missiles from the Engels area of the Saratov Region and the Kursk Region (Russian Federation); – 6 X-47M2 Kinzhal aeroballistic missiles from the airspace of the Lipetsk Region (Russian Federation).

The main target of the strike was Volyn, the city of Lutsk.

The air attack was repelled by aviation, anti-aircraft missile forces, electronic warfare units and unmanned systems, and mobile fire groups of the Defence Forces.

According to preliminary data, as of 08:30, air defence forces destroyed 718 Russian air attack vehicles, 303 were shot down by firepower, and 415 were lost due to location:

  • 296 Russian Shahed-type UAVs (other types of drones) were shot down by firepower, 415 were lost/suppressed by electronic warfare;
  • 7 X-101/Iskander-K cruise missiles were shot down.
